Biography

Jemal H. Abawajy (Senior Member, IEEE) is currently a Full Professor with the Faculty of Science, Engineering, and Built Environment, Deakin University, Australia. His leadership is extensive spanning industrial, academic, and professional areas. He is also the Director of the Distribution System Security (DSS). He has been actively involved in the organization of more than 200 national and international conferences, including the chair, the general co-chair, the vice-chair, the best paper award chair, the publication chair, the session chair, and a program committee member. He is also actively involved in funded research supervising, a large number of Ph.D. students, postdoctoral researchers, research assistants, and visiting scholars, in the area of cloud computing, big data, network and system security, and e-health. He is the author/coauthor of five books and ten conference volumes, and more than 250 referenced articles in conferences, book chapters, and journals. He is a Senior Member of the IEEE Technical Committee on Scalable Computing (TCSC), the IEEE Technical Committee on Dependable Computing and Fault Tolerance, and the IEEE Communication Society. He served on the editorial board for numerous international journals.
